Exploring the Technology behind AI Text to Video Creation

⁤ ⁢ The transformation of textual ⁢content into vibrant video formats‍ is made possible through a⁢ series of advanced⁣ technologies that‌ converge to create stunning visuals. At the core of AI text-to-video creation lies⁢ Natural Language Processing‌ (NLP), which enables machines to ‌understand and interpret the nuances of human language. This technology ⁢analyzes the input ⁣text,extracting ‍key elements⁤ such ⁢as themes,sentiments,and contextual cues.⁤

⁢ Together with ‌NLP, Computer Vision⁢ plays a crucial role in visualizing⁣ these texts.⁢ It employs⁢ algorithms to recognize and synthesize images that best⁤ represent the textual descriptions. Deep learning​ models trained on vast datasets help in generating appropriate graphics that‍ align⁣ with the narrative being presented.For ⁢example:

Text Sample Generated ​Visuals
A serene sunset ⁢over a quiet lake Images​ of vibrant ⁢skies reflecting​ on water
A bustling city street at rush hour Frames depicting⁣ crowded sidewalks and busy traffic

​ ‍ ‌Beyond NLP and Computer Vision, the integration of generative Adversarial Networks (GANs) ‌ has revolutionized how ‌video content is generated. GANs consist of two⁤ neural networks: ‍a generator that creates visuals, and a discriminator⁤ that evaluates them.⁣ This dynamic interaction allows the​ system ⁣to⁤ improve the⁤ quality of the visuals iteratively,producing animations​ that are not only ⁢realistic but also engaging. As a result,AI-driven ​video creation ​tools can rapidly transform ⁣mere words into captivating stories,bridging​ the gap between imagination‍ and reality.

Guidelines ⁢for Crafting Effective ‌prompts‍ for⁤ Stunning Visual​ Outputs

Creating prompts that yield stunning visual outputs through AI technology requires a⁤ combination of clarity, creativity, and specificity. Here are key‌ strategies to⁤ consider:

  • Be Specific: When formulating your⁤ prompt, use precise language. Rather of saying “a landscape,” you might describe “a vibrant‍ sunset over a ​serene lake with mountains in‌ the background.” this ‌specificity helps the AI understand your​ vision ⁣better.
  • Use⁢ Descriptive Language: Rich and evocative adjectives can enhance your prompt substantially. Think​ about‍ textures, colors, and emotions. instead of simply⁢ stating‍ “a cat,” ⁤you could say ​“a fluffy ginger cat lounging in a sunlit⁤ window.”
  • Incorporate Actions: Prompts that include dynamic elements often result in more engaging visuals. for‌ example, “a young girl joyfully flying a colorful kite on⁣ a breezy day” creates a lively ‍scene compared ⁤to a static description.
  • Combine ⁣Elements: Don’t hesitate to mix⁤ different⁤ aspects into your prompt. As an example, “a futuristic city skyline at ‍twilight with flying cars and‍ glowing neon ⁢signs”​ provides a ⁢vivid picture that​ combines‍ time, place, and action.

Challenges and Limitations of Current​ AI Text to Video ​Solutions

Despite ‍the remarkable advancements in AI-driven​ text-to-video technology, several challenges ‌and limitations continue to ⁣hinder its full potential. one of​ the primary issues is ⁣the difficulty ‌in ‌accurately interpreting context and nuances in text. While AI models⁢ excel at generating visuals from explicit descriptions, ⁢they often struggle with implicit‌ meanings or cultural references, leading‍ to generated content that ⁢may miss the intended message or emotional ​undertone. For instance,‌ humor or sarcasm⁣ can be particularly ⁤challenging for AI, resulting ⁣in visuals that do not resonate with viewers.

Another meaningful ‍hurdle is the quality of⁤ generated visuals. Current algorithms may produce⁢ high-quality images, but‌ transitioning⁤ those still images into ⁤fluid video⁣ formats is​ still a work ‍in progress. Issues such as frame coherence ⁣and motion realism often ‌arise, where the sequence of frames lacks continuity, leading ‍to jarring transitions that distract from the narrative flow. This⁣ inconsistency can undermine⁢ the viewer’s engagement and perception of professionalism in the content.

Additionally, ‍there are limitations in terms of content diversity and representation. AI systems are often trained on⁢ specific datasets⁤ that can lead to biased outputs, reflecting ⁤only a narrow slice‌ of reality. Such as, ⁣when⁤ generating videos featuring people, the system might default to representing a specific demographic over⁢ others,⁢ thus failing to capture the⁤ full richness of human diversity. This raises ethical ​questions about representation in media​ and the responsibility of developers to ensure inclusivity in their AI outputs.

issues related to computational resources ⁤and accessibility also play a critical role ​in⁤ the adoption of‌ text-to-video technologies. High-quality video ‌rendering requires substantial processing power, which‌ may ‍not ‌be accessible to all content ⁣creators, especially those with limited budgets.Moreover, the steep⁢ learning curve associated with some of these⁢ tools can deter potential users, limiting ⁤the​ widespread adoption and innovation in this fascinating ‌intersection of AI and ⁤creativity.
